Read the given statements and conclusions carefully.
Assuming that the information given in the statements is true, even if it appears to be at variance with commonly known facts, decide which of the given conclusions logically follow(s) from the statements. Statements: Some Flowers are Leaves. All Flowers are Stems. No leaf is Petal. Conclusion: I. No Flower is Petal. II. Some Stems are Leaves. III. Some Stems are not Petals.Solution
Some Flowers are Leaves (I) + No leaf is Petal (E) β Some Flowers are not Petals (O). Hence conclusion I does not follow. Some Flowers are Leaves (I) β Conversion β Some Leaves are Flowers (I) + All Flowers are Stems (I) β Some Leaves are Stems (I) β Conversion β Some Stems are Leaves (I). Hence conclusion II follows. Some Stems are Leaves (I) + No leaf is Petal (E) β Some Stems are not Petals (O). Hence conclusion III follows.
